山体滑坡冲走了他们在狮子湾的家,Barbara 和 David Enns 的尸体被发现。 Bodies of Barbara and David Enns found after landslide swept away their Lions Bay home.
不列颠哥伦比亚省狮子湾的紧急救援人员找到了Barbara和David Enns的尸体,他们于12月14日被山崩冲走。 Emergency crews in Lions Bay, British Columbia, recovered the bodies of Barbara and David Enns, who were swept away by a landslide on December 14. 山崩摧毁了他们的家园,暂时关闭了海与天空高速公路的连接。 The landslide destroyed their home and temporarily closed the Sea to Sky Highway. 第一具尸体是12月15日发现的,第二具尸体是12月21日发现的。 The first body was found on December 15, and the second on December 21. 狮子湾村市长表示哀悼,并表示向受影响者提供资源,包括咨询和财政援助。 The Village of Lions Bay Mayor expressed condolences and stated that resources, including counselling and financial assistance, are available to those affected. 山崩原因正在调查之中,当地紧急状态仍然有效。 The cause of the landslide is under investigation, with a state of local emergency still in effect.
